/ˈsoʊʃəl ˈsɛtɪŋ/

Definition
A social setting refers to the environment or context in which social interactions and relationships occur.

Examples
- The café provided a relaxed social setting for friends to meet and catch up.
- In a formal social setting, such as a wedding, guests are expected to dress appropriately.
- Online gaming creates a unique social setting where players can interact in real-time.

Meaning
It describes the place or circumstances that influence how individuals engage with one another, including the cultural, physical, and situational factors at play.

Synonyms
- Social environment
- Social context
- Social atmosphere
- Social scene
